Germany urges EU to support Cuban reforms
German Foreign Minister Frank-Walter Steinmeier has called on the 
European Union to support reforms in Cuba. Speaking in Berlin, the 
minister said the changes initiated by Raul Castro were "small 
developments and not merely gestures". He added that further progress 
also depended on Europe supporting the Cuban reform process. Communist 
Cuba recently commuted the death penalty for some dissidents. Raul 
Castro, the brother of longterm state leader Fidel, has also eased 
restrictions which prevented individuals from owning computers, DVD 
players and mobile phones. The EU is split over its future policy 
towards Cuba. Some members are against establishing closer ties, because 
of the country's human rights violations.
